Unity Music Festival and Volunteer Opportunities
Unity Music Festival is an annual concert festival at Muskegon’s Heritage Landing August 8-11th. There are lots of great concerts, food vendors, kids activities, teens tent and alternative music stage.
Check out their website for the artists schedule and ticket information! Unity Festival Website
If you have been to Unity or just want a difference experience maybe this would be a good year to volunteer. Experience Unity Festival from the inside out and receive free tickets, a t-shirt and parking pass the day you volunteer. http://www.unitymusicfestival.com/volunteer.php

New Year, New Series!
In case you missed it at Journey Teens Sunday Night we talked about setting our actions in the direction of our desired destination.
When you get in a car to drive to the mall if you don’t take the right roads you’re not going to end up at the mall! The same is true in other aspects of life, however the directions and road maps are a little harder to follow. If we want to be an NFL player then we are going to have to do more than wish it is going to happen and watch a lot of football. Even harder sometimes is knowing what the destination should look like and making plans to get there.
When we focus our attention on pleasing God the steps we need to take can be confusing. But, we don’t want that to get in our way of living out His plan for our lives. In Jeremiah 29:11 we learn about God’s character. That he has a plan for hope and a future, it is our job to live out our part to make it happen.
Here are some questions we asked in groups last night to get us thinking about the future. What are your goals, what are your plans? Do they line up with God’s plan? Do you know how to find out what your next step is? Who is going to help you live out those Goals? Who is going to make it harder to reach them?
